Bridgestone Battlax Adventurecross Scrambler AX41S combines the visual appeal of an off-road tyre with modern road performance, specifically targeting scrambler and retro adventure bikes. With large, flat block patterns and a softer compound, it’s made for urban rides, twisty back roads, and dry gravel trails — not true off-road abuse. Think of it as a fashion-forward tyre that still delivers safe, sporty handling in mixed conditions.

Performance
The AX41S isn’t built for true mud or wet dirt. While the block pattern may give some initial grip, it clogs quickly and has limited self-cleaning ability.
Dry gravel or compact forest roads are manageable, especially with light bikes. Still, the block spacing is too tight for high-speed trail confidence.
Performs better than pure road tyres on slick surfaces like wet grass or cobbles, but lacks the bite or depth to dig in when things get properly slippery.
Excellent road manners. Designed for performance on tarmac, it offers a sportbike-like ride while maintaining the rugged look.
Great grip in wet weather thanks to the high silica compound. While not a rain tyre, it gives predictable braking and cornering in wet urban conditions.
Durability
Not built for repeated off-road use. Occasional gravel is fine, but aggressive trail riding will wear or damage the tyre quickly.
Durable for street use, with many riders reporting 5,000–8,000 miles depending on load and riding style. The compound balances grip and wear well.
